In need of building materials for the loft in the off grid log cabin and log sauna, Cali and I snowshoe through the deep snow in the forest to the grove of dead trees that burned in a lightening strike, seeking out a large black cherry tree that I have had my eye on for two years. I plan to mill it into planks and beams to renovate the sleeping loft, adding storage for clothes and more. I use an axe to cut down the tree - much more exhausting than I anticipated because the wood is seasoned and frozen. With few groceries left in the pantry, I cook an unusual meal of ground ostrich with onions, garlic, zucchini, celery and spices.

This was such a cool video. I found myself actually holding my breath. I love how you explain things. When I was younger, I remember when my dad had a tree hang he showed us boys how to use a block and tackle. He said, make sure you have lots and lots of rope for your block and tackle. I remember being impressed about where he said to attach the loop for the block and tackle. He said, don’t bother trying to throw the rope up the tree you want to pull down. He explained that it is actually less for the block and tackle to pull the tree down from the base, the bottom, of the tree, in the opposite direction of where the top of the tree is. We watched him and it was so effortless to get that tree to fall. He only had to re-attach the other end of the block and tackle about 4 times, but then the tree came all the way down. He explained that if the rope on the block and tackle was shorter, he would have to re-attach the other end to new tree bases more often.

Another Bohemian Cuisine suggestion for you; try boiling that jar of sauerkraut in a liter of water with a little sugar, bay leaf and caraway seed for about 60min. Towards the end of cooking add some sautéed onions and garlic and grate one potato into the cabbage. Maybe add a teaspoon of paprika if the color is offputting to you. I find that most people don't like sauerkraut because they have never had it cooked properly.
